こんにちはゲストさん。会員登録(無料)して質問・回答してみよう!

解決済みの質問

VLOOKUPのTRUEとFALSEの意味は

Excel2010を使っています。VLOOKUP関数を使うときに、検索掛ける値と掛けられる値が一致しなくてもいい時は、例えば=VLOOKUP(A8,E8:G30,3,TRUE)などと書きます。完全に一致する検索の場合は、TRUEではなくFALSEを入れます。
 このTRUE(真)とFALSE(偽)の意味は何でしょうか。どう解釈すると覚えやすい(説明しやすい)でしょうか。

投稿日時 - 2014-08-03 13:25:25

QNo.8702795

困ってます

質問者が選んだベストアンサー

使い方で覚えます。
一例ですが
重量などある範囲で料金が決まっていて検索をかける場合
TRUE
50~100gの間などで 60gと云った一致しない検索値

品名など、固定した値で、価格が決まっている場合
FALSE

画像を添付しておきます。

なぜ 完全一致が FALSE で 近似が TRUE とかは
わかりません。

投稿日時 - 2014-08-03 15:35:56

お礼

回答ありがとうございます。
>なぜ 完全一致が FALSE で 近似が TRUE とかはわかりません。
 これが正解でしょうか。

投稿日時 - 2014-08-03 16:02:15

このQ&Aは役に立ちましたか?

9人が「このQ&Aが役に立った」と投票しています

回答(4)

ANo.3

こちらを見て下さい。

http://www.itc.u-toyama.ac.jp/el/spreadsheet/vlookup.html

投稿日時 - 2014-08-03 15:02:57

お礼

回答ありがとうございます。いまいち分かりません? 他の方の意見のように、単にそういう決まりとしましょうか。

投稿日時 - 2014-08-03 16:00:51

ANo.2

私は、

値が一致しなかったのが(false)で、
その時に値が(無理から)一致した(true)と解釈する。と解釈していますが。

投稿日時 - 2014-08-03 14:34:12

お礼

回答ありがとうございます。

投稿日時 - 2014-08-03 15:57:45

ANo.1

>このTRUE(真)とFALSE(偽)の意味は何でしょうか。
特別に意味がある訳ではなく仕様で決められ記述になっているだけと考えてください。

>どう解釈すると覚えやすい(説明しやすい)でしょうか。
丸暗記してください。
覚えられないときは数式入力のウィザードで引数の説明を見ながら入力すると良いでしょう。

投稿日時 - 2014-08-03 14:18:32

お礼

回答ありがとうございます。
>特別に意味がある訳ではなく仕様で決められ記述になっているだけと考えてください。
 そうですか。IF文などは、「真」「偽」明確に意味が分かるんですけどね。Microsoftの開発者にでも聞くと分かるのでしょうね。

投稿日時 - 2014-08-03 15:55:56

あなたにオススメの質問